Answer:

  F(-4, 2)

Step-by-step explanation:

The translation by (1, 2) is described by the transformation ...

  (x, y) ⇒ (x +1, y +2)

The reflection across the y-axis is described by the transformation ...

  (x, y) ⇒ (-x, y)

The reflection operating on the translation is then described by ...

  (x, y) ⇒ (-x -1, y +2)

The inverse transformation will be ...

  (x, y) ⇒ (-x -1, y -2)

Using this inverse transformation on the given image points, we find the original parallelogram points to be ...

  F"(3, 4) ⇒ F(-4, 2) . . . . . the requested coordinates

  G"(2, 2) ⇒ G(-3, 0)

  H"(4, 2) ⇒ H(-5, 0)

  J"(5, 4) ⇒ J(-6, 2)
